About This Trial

This study aims to evaluate the effectiveness of therapeutic hypothermia in neonates diagnosed with hypoxic-ischemic encephalopathy (HIE). The study focuses on assessing both short-term outcomes after treatment and long-term neurological outcomes following therapeutic hypothermia.
